PROPERTY COUNCIL COMMENDS THE SUCCESS OF CHRISTMAS LUNCH IN THE PARK

Mission Australia’s Christmas Lunch in the Park was a huge success with more than 1200 of Perth’s marginalised people enjoying a Christmas feast of Kailis Bros West Australian Rock Lobsters*, Mondo Doro leg ham, wrapped chocolate and cranberry Christmas puddings and shortbread.

The Property Council WA and our members came out in strong support for the fantastic initiatives of Mission Australia, including Christmas Lunch in the Park. Together we have raised almost $90,000 in the last 12 months. The 2018 WA Property Council Christmas lunch held at Crown Perth raised almost $30,000 for Mission Australia alone!

Following the success of the Property Council Christmas Lunch, the WA Property Council team joined forces with Foodbank’s Perth headquarters and Mission Australia to help put together 1,200 care packs, which were distributed to attendees at the Christmas Lunch in the Park.

“Although it’s primarily about providing a festive meal, company and entertainment for Perth’s most vulnerable, it also provides an important means of linking attendees to support services to extend the benefit beyond the day,” State Director Mission Australia WA, Jo Sadler said.

Now in its 43rd year, Christmas Lunch in the Park, in Perth’s Wellington Square, is the longest running charity lunch of its kind in Australia. It has served up more than 60,000 meals to those in need since it was first held in Perth in 1975.

The event was the result of months of planning and teamwork by Mission Australia staff and volunteers who willingly gave up their Christmas day with family and friends to come together to make sure the day was a memorable one for all of those who attended.

As well as a festive feast for 1200, last year’s event included gifts for all the children, live music, face painting and a guest appearance from Father Christmas.
